Theißen, Saxony-Anhalt, Germany

Overview

Theißen is a small, tranquil village in Saxony-Anhalt, Germany, known for its close-knit community and rural charm. With its historical buildings, scenic riverbanks, and nearby vineyards, Theißen offers visitors a relaxed glimpse into local life in central Germany.

Best Time to Visit

April-June for mild spring weather and blooming countryside.

Local Tips

Shops may close early, especially on Sundays; plan meals and shopping in advance. The village is easily explored by foot or bicycle.

Cultural Etiquette

Germans typically greet with a friendly 'Guten Tag.' Tipping 5–10% is customary in restaurants. Dress is casual but neat; avoid loud or flashy attire.

Safety Warnings

Theißen is considered very safe, but be aware of limited street lighting at night in outlying areas. Watch for cyclists on shared paths.

Hidden Gems

Explore the riverside trails along the Elster, visit the village's historic church, or discover local bakeries for traditional German pastries.
